I've always had a high idle...aroudn 1500rpm...once I tried to lower it but even with the cabl;e loose adn teh stop screw undone it still stayed at 1500.....

now my problem has resurfaced....now the car won't kick off teh choke(or thats what it feels like) adn runs at 2g's where my choke is around 2300 or there abouts....

I pulled it apart last night and hit it with some carb cleaner...didn't work....plated around with it a bit adn fiddled with the choke....didn't work....
it just looks lik ethe choke isn't working or somehitng....likeit doesn't go to vertical position when the car is warm.....

it's pain in the ass driving the car adn siting at lights reving 2g's...

anybody know what mioght be the problem??

is there an idle control valve on these suckers?? adn is there more ways to adjust the idle then with the cable and bump stop?

Your fast idle unloader is either stuck (doubt it) or the vacuum hose fell off and it is stuck constantly in fast idle (this could cause the choke to not open) or the thermovalve is stuck shut. Remove the vacuum hose to the fast idle unloader and apply vacuum to it, the shaft should retract and you should be able to lower the idle speed by tapping the throttle once.
